ABSTRACT:
A process for the manufacture of d,l-.alpha.-tocopherol by condensing trimethylhydroquinone with isophytol comprises carrying out the condensation in the presence of a polyperfluoroalkylenesulphonic acid as the catalyst and in a solvent, especially an aprotic solvent. The catalyst is preferably a polyperfluoroalkylenesulphonic acid from the Nafion.RTM. series, e.g., Nafion NR 50.RTM. or Nafion 117.RTM..
